Examine and Seal Entrance Things
To avoid future insect invasions, regularly check and quickly seal any kind of possible access points in your house. Begin by analyzing locations like windows, doors, vents, and pipelines for any type of spaces or splits that pests could utilize to get in. Usage caulk or weatherstripping to secure these openings successfully. Remember to check for openings in displays and voids around cables or wires entering your home.
Examine your structure for splits and crevices, as insects like rodents and bugs can conveniently sneak in with these openings. Seal any voids you locate with the proper materials, such as cement or cord mesh. Don't neglect to check areas where various materials meet, as these joints can produce entrance points if not effectively sealed.
Routine upkeep is key to keeping bugs out. Make it a routine to inspect your home every three months and deal with any type of potential access points promptly. By staying attentive and positive, you can dramatically decrease the threat of future bug invasions.
Practice Correct Food Storage
Correctly storing food is vital in protecting against bug invasions. Keep all food things in sealed containers to refute pests very easy accessibility. Ensure to store dry goods like grains and grains in airtight containers to discourage pantry parasites like weevils and beetles.
Avoid leaving food out on kitchen counters or tables, as this can bring in ants, flies, and various other parasites. In the refrigerator, shop fruits and vegetables in the crisper cabinet and maintain all leftovers in snugly sealed containers to prevent odors from tempting parasites. On a regular basis look for any type of indicators of food wasting and immediately discard any kind of items that have gone bad.
Additionally, do not forget animal food-- store it in closed containers too. By practicing proper food storage practices, you can substantially minimize the risk of drawing in bugs right into your home and stop future infestations.
